Raw Score and FC Confusion
Forgive me for being somewhat confused. I've searched for an answer but couldn't find one. x.x;
On my profile, I have those bars that show my AAA's, FC's, and tier points. If I FC a song, but later on get a better raw score on it, do I technically keep the song as "FC'D" (like does it stay FC'd according to the bar indicator)? Cause now I'm not sure which The Games We've Played I've actually FC'd or not.

Re: Raw Score and FC Confusion
afaik raw score overrules fc
so 0-0-1-0 will beat 20-0-0-0 I've lost many fc's since this change sorry to say if you wanna keep your fc's you'll need to have fc'd on your pb Last edited by Mourningfall; 09-16-2016 at 04:14 AM.. |

Re: Raw Score and FC Confusion
I'd rather have a separate bar for SDG to be honest - you should classify them separately, like a non FC could get you a SDG, an FC with tons of boos would just get you an FC, and something like a blackflag would be both.
I've always wanted an SDG bar, I've tried to make one but the API is so junky that some songs don't have good counts, averages returned, so you can't even accurately calculate it.. The closest I ever got was when I extended the api to get advanced stats, but that still sucks because it counts duplicates (e.g. if you SDG the same song twice, you get 2) and is only from like mid April. I have theories on unique method I've thought of to get this and other data, it's pretty slimey but it could theoretically work, still need to try to implement it though. Quote:
That being said, alot of what I'm about to say is just guessing, but I predict that FFR doesn't save every single score ever obtained, the amount of data would simply be too massive, do you also notice how on the profile, you can view a user's last 15 plays, or even looking at the API - there is a function to return a user's last 15 games, so logically I'd say they only store data on your last 15 (I checked and it's actually 10 but I don't want to reword this on my phone). I'd figure someone has looked into this, and unfortunately there's no viable way - with how it's designed now, either they'd have to also save scores separately (your best FC on a song, and your best score), which would obviously create an extra piece of data per song (would cause calculating stats to be even slower), or they would have to store all your plays, which is not viable at all. (honestly the first option sounds like it could be possible, but unsure if it would be worth it for this small bug) The limitations of the engine from my predictions above are unfortunately why this stuff happens, and it's not as simple to fix. It's not unintended behaviour, the game isn't actively removing your score - it just simply saves your best score, and with how the engine is designed, it wouldn't be viable to save more than that :/ Lol damn this is what happens when you spend all day in class studying this stuff ^ Tl;dr pls open source this game so we can all work on moving to a new system, cuz spaghetti code doesn't taste as good as it sounds.
